четверг, 23 марта 2017 г.

Двохвимірні масиви


     В програмуванні масив (англ. array) — одна з найпростіших структур даних, сукупність елементів переважно одного типу даних, впорядкованих за індексами, які зазвичай репрезентовані натуральними числами, що визначають положення елемента в масиві. 
      Масив може бути одновимірним (вектором), та багатовимірним (наприклад, двовимірною таблицею), тобто таким, де індексом є не одне число, а кортеж (сукупність) з декількох чисел, кількість яких співпадає з розмірністю масива. 
В переважній більшості мов програмування масив є стандартною вбудованою структурою даних. 

      Масив – це змінна, утворена послідовністю змінних, причому: 
         усі вони (компоненти, або елементи масиву) мають той самий тип; 
         кожний компонент має свій номер у послідовності (індекс) і відрізняється ним від інших елементів (ідентифікується); 
         множина індексів (індексова множина) скінченна й зафіксована в означенні масиву та в процесі виконання програми не змінюється; 
         можливість обробки компонента, або його доступність, не залежить від його місця в послідовності (елементи рівнодоступні). 

      Двовимірні масиви. Елементи двовимірного масиву (дані можуть бути подані у вигляді таблиці) визначаються іменем масиву та двома індексами: перший індекс означає номер рядка, другий - номер стовпця, на перетині яких стоїть елемент, наприклад р[1,2], p[i,j]. 


Створити двохвимірний масив. Заповнити його випадковими числами

















static void Main(string[] args)
  {
  
   int[,]multMatr;
   multMatr = new int[10,10];
   
    for (int i = 1; i <= 9; i++)
   for (int j = 1; j < 9; j++)
   multMatr[i, j] = i * j;
  
   for (int i = 1; i <= 9; i++)
   {
    for (int j = 1; j <= 9; j++)
    {
     Console.Write(multMatr [i, j] + "\t");
    }
    Console.WriteLine();
   }

Комментариев нет:

Отправить комментарий